Our search for new resonances decaying to WW, ZZ, or WZ is presented. Final states are considered in which one of the vector bosons decays leptonically and the other hadronically. Results are based on data corresponding to an integrated luminosity of 19.7 fb-1 recorded in proton-proton collisions at √s = 8 TeV with the CMS detector at the CERN LHC. Techniques aiming at identifying jet substructures are used to analyze signal events in which the hadronization products from the decay of highly boosted W or Z bosons are contained within a single reconstructed jet. Upper limits on the production of generic WW, ZZ, or WZ resonances are set as a function of the resonance mass and width. We also increase the sensitivity of the analysis by statistically combining the results of this search with a complementary study of the all-hadronic final state. Upper limits at 95% confidence level are set on the bulk graviton production cross section in the range from 700 to 10 fb for resonance masses between 600 and 2500 GeV, respectively. These limits on the bulk graviton model are the most stringent to date in the diboson final state.

The book discusses the recent experimental results obtained at the LHC that involve electroweak bosons. The results are placed into an appropriate theoretical and historical context. The work pays special attention to the rising subject of hadronically decaying bosons with high boosts, documenting the state-of-the-art identification techniques and highlighting typical results. The text is not limited to electroweak physics in the strict sense, but also discusses the use of electroweak vector-bosons as tool in the study of other subjects in particle physics, such as determinations of the proton structure or the search for new exotic particles. The book is particularly well suited for graduate students, starting their thesis work on topics that involve electroweak bosons, as the book provides a comprehensive description of phenomena observable at current accelerators as well as a summary of the most relevant experimental techniques.

This book introduces the reader to the field of jet substructure, starting from the basic considerations for capturing decays of boosted particles in individual jets, to explaining state-of-the-art techniques. Jet substructure methods have become ubiquitous in data analyses at the LHC, with diverse applications stemming from the abundance of jets in proton-proton collisions, the presence of pileup and multiple interactions, and the need to reconstruct and identify decays of highly-Lorentz boosted particles. The last decade has seen a vast increase in our knowledge of all aspects of the field, with a proliferation of new jet substructure algorithms, calculations and measurements which are presented in this book. Recent developments and algorithms are described and put into the larger experimental context. Their usefulness and application are shown in many demonstrative examples and the phenomenological and experimental effects influencing their performance are discussed. A comprehensive overview is given of measurements and searches for new phenomena performed by the ATLAS and CMS Collaborations. This book shows the impressive versatility of jet substructure methods at the LHC.

This thesis presents several studies in the search for new physics in the production of electroweak gauge bosons pairs with 36 $fb^{-1}$ of proton-proton collisions measured by the ATLAS detector. Processes with electroweak gauge bosons in the final state are sensitive to new physics which alter the electroweak or Higgs sector of the Standard Model. The studies are conducted in the ``semileptonic" decay channels, where one of the electroweak gauge bosons decays hadronically and the other decays leptonically. The groundwork of these studies is established in a search for a new resonant particle which can decay on-shell to pairs of $W/Z$ bosons in the $\ell\nu qq$ channel. No significant excess of data with respect to the background prediction was observed. Therefore, upper limits at the 95\% CLs confidence level are placed on the possible resonant masses in a strongly coupled Heavy Vector Triplet model and on Bulk Randall-Sundrum Gravitons at 3 TeV and 1.7 TeV, respectively. These results are expanded upon with a dedicated study on an ATLAS-wide combination of resonant diboson and dilepton search results. The combination improves the 95\% CLs upper excluded mass values to 5.5 TeV and 2.1 TeV, respectively. In conjunction, a search for non-resonant new physics is conducted through a measurement of the electroweak vector-boson scattering in all semileptonic channels. Evidence for the process was observed at a significance of $2.7\sigma$ and a fiducial cross-section measurement of $\sigma=45.1\pm8.6\,(\mathrm{stat.})^{+15.9}_{-14.6} \,(\mathrm{syst.})$ fb was extracted, consistent with the Standard Model prediction. Lastly, both the prospects of the $\ell\nu qq$ resonance search and the measurement of vector-boson scattering in the High-Luminosity LHC era were evaluated. With 3000 $fb^{-1}$ of proton-proton data, the upper mass limits on new resonances in the $\ell\nu qq$ channel are expected to increase by 1.3 - 2 TeV depending on the benchmark model and the vector-boson scattering cross-section is expected to be measured at the percent level.
